"Slumber Party Massacre II" follows Courtney, who survived the first film's events as a child, and now as a teenager is plagued by horrible night terrors in which the killer has reincarnated as a greaser armed with a drill bit-adorned guitar. She and her friends, who have their own band, go away for Courtney's birthday weekend to one of the girls' parents' condominium, located in an undeveloped complex out of town. Needless to say, the killer crashes the party.This is a film that I expected to hate based on the sheer absurdity of the plot synopsis, but I'll be damned in this isn't one of the more fun late-eighties slasher entries. It's patently ridiculous-everything from the killer's methods of dispatching victims to the corny rockabilly tunes he belts out as he stalks them. He looks like an extra from "Grease" crossed with a late-eighties Los Angeles hair-metal singer, but there is something bizarrely charming about the character."A Nightmare on Elm Street" was a clear influence here, and the film is chock full of overt references to other films, primarily in the characters' tongue-in-cheek names. Speaking of the characters, they are each wildly likable, and the performers are all attractive and have a spunky chemistry that makes the proceedings even more fun. The film is also surprisingly well-shot for a production of this caliber. At 75 minutes, the film is lean and mean, with most of the slasher action barreling onscreen around the 60-minute mark. The ending is silly, but somewhat ties up some loose ends as to why on earth the hapless teens are being stalked by such a ridiculous villain.In the end, "Slumber Party Massacre II" is logistically a much better film than it should be. The premise is absurd and its serves up the late-eighties cheese that a faction of slasher devotees live for. I couldn't help myself from enjoying all of it, from its most absurd elements to its most competent. 7/10.

This amusingly goofy sequel to the tremendously trashy early 80's slice'n'dice winner "The Slumber Party Massacre" eschews serious scares in favor of gleefully inane laughs. The killer this time is some scruffy and sleazy rock'n'roll singer psycho who has an enormous drill bit affixed to the end of his guitar. This nutzoid sub-Elvis Presley homicidal lunatic stalks and murders the members of an all-girl rock band spending the weekend at a fancy condominium. Writer/director Deborah Brock plays the whole ridiculous premise for cheerfully silly humor with the psychobilly singer making for a hilariously campy villain. Atanas Ilitch has himself a hammy field day as our gloriously gonzo fruitcake wacko (his absurd song and dance musical number "Let's Buzz" rates as a definite gut-busting comic highlight). Moreover, Crystal Bernard makes for a most fetching and appealing heroine as the sweet Courtney.
